Ferm is a tool for maintaining and installing complex firewall rules. It allows you to reduce the monotonous task of embedding rules and chains, allowing the firewall administrator to spend more time developing good rules and reducing the appropriate implementation time for these rules. These rules will be the preferred kernel interfaces executed, like IPChains and iptables. Firewall rules can also be split into different files and loaded.
Ferm 2.1 This version can better support the ipv4/http://www.aliyun.com/zixun/aggregation/9485.html ">ipv6 blending rules, the detailed update log is as follows:
-new functions @basename, @dirname, @ipfilter
-add Automatic variables $FILENAME, $LINE
-updated NetFilter Modules:
* Pkg-type:support Negation
* Set: "--match set" support for newer iptables
-updated ebtables Support:
* Use Per-protocol Options
* Add support for-p ARP--arp-gratuitous
* Support Abbreviations in arguments
* Add support for matching IPV6
* Add support for "among" match
* Add support for the "limit" match
-honor--noflush in fast mode
-discard previous specifications when @if fails
-use the--domain argument as the default domain
-keep track of line numbers within custom function calls
